There's a term called "necessary frequency coordination," and they don't actually use the entire 20 MHz range from 450-470 MHz. Furthermore, MIIT has only approved the continued use of 450 MHz analog frequencies until the end of 2028, and it is rumored that they will eventually be reclaimed (with a planned change to **(Details regarding the MHz digital communication system are not discussed here). Currently, the radio licenses for various units, as well as the approval of standard and non-standard radios used in vehicles by both the National Railway Bureau and local wireless management departments, all have expiration dates before December 31, 2028.
